Abstract :
The advent of advances in power system instrumentation has made possible a range of time synchronized measurements of voltages and currents in full phasor form. These synchronized measurements can be used for direct digital control of the system including voltage control, restoration of service after an outage, stability assessment and subsequent enhancement, and system operation in such a way as to improve expected reliability. This paper contains a discussion of synchronized measurements and their communication and data processing platform hardware and software requirements. Some specific examples are given.
